面向MapReduce的Hadoop优化: Chinese Edition

·
· Packt Publishing Ltd
ଇବୁକ୍
110
ପୃଷ୍ଠାଗୁଡ଼ିକ

ଏହି ଇବୁକ୍ ବିଷୟରେ

汇聚社区经验精华,阐述配置Hadoop集群运行最优MapReduce作业的方法Key Features
  • 原理与实践相结合,通过原理讲解影响MapReduce性能的因素
  • 透过实例一步步地教读者如何发现性能瓶颈并消除瓶颈,如何识别系统薄弱环节并改善薄弱环节
  • 讲解过程中融合了作者在优化实践过程中积累的丰富经验,具有很强的针对性
  • 既覆盖了系统层面的优化又覆盖程序层面的优化
Book Description大数据时代,MapReduce的重要性不言而喻。Hadoop作为MapReduce框架的一个实现,受到业界广泛的认同,并被广泛部署和应用。尽管Hadoop为数据开发工程师入门和编程提供了极大便利,但构造一个真正满足性能要求的MapReduce程序并不简单。数据量巨大是大数据工作的现实问题,而对低响应时间的要求则时常困扰着数据开发工程师。 本书采用原理与实践相结合的方式,通过原理讲解影响MapReduce性能的因素,透过实例一步步地教读者如何发现性能瓶颈并消除瓶颈,如何识别系统薄弱环节并改善薄弱环节,讲解过程中融合了作者在优化实践过程中积累的丰富经验,具有很强的针对性。读完本书,能让读者对Hadoop具有更强的驾驭能力,从而构造出性能最优的MapReduce程序。 Hadoop性能问题既是程序层面的问题,也是系统层面的问题。本书既覆盖了系统层面的优化又覆盖了程序层面的优化,非常适合Hadoop管理员和有经验的数据开发工程师阅读。对于初学者,本书第1章也作了必要的技术铺垫,避免对后面章节的理解产生梯度。What you will learn
  • 量化Hadoop集群的节点配置
  • 利用Hadoop MapReduce性能计数器判断资源瓶颈
  • 正确设置mapper和reducer的数量
  • 使用压缩技术和Combiner优化map和reduce任务的吞吐量和代码量
  • 理解各种调优属性以及优化集群的最佳实践
  • 判断Hadoop集群的薄弱环节
  • 了解影响MapReduce性能的因素
Who this book is for

对于Hadoop系统管理员、开发人员、MapReduce使用者或者初学者而言,本书是优化集群和应用程序的最佳选择。读者不必事先具备创建MapReduce应用程序的知识,但具备这些知识有助于增进对概念的理解,更有助于理解MapReduce类模板代码片段。

ଅଧିକ ଡିସ୍କଭର କରନ୍ତୁ

ଲେଖକଙ୍କ ବିଷୟରେ

Khaled Tannirhas从1980年开始从事计算机相关工作。他是微软认证的开发人员(MCSD),他在领导软件解决方案的开发和实施以及技术演说方面,拥有20多年技术经验。如今,他是一名独立IT咨询师,并在法国、加拿大的许多大公司担任基础设施工程师、高级研发工程师、企业/解决方案架构师等职务。他在Microsoft.NET、Microsoft服务器系统、Oracle Java技术等领域拥有丰富的经验,并且熟练驾驭在线和离线应用系统设计、系统转换以及多语言的互联网/桌面应用程序开发。Khaled Tnnirhas总是热衷于探索和学习新的技术,并基于这些技术在法国、北美、中东等地区寻求商机。他现在拥有一个IT电子实验室,实验室中配备了很多服务器、监控器、开源电子板(如Arduino、Netduino、RaspBerry Pi和.Net Gadgeteer),还有一些装有Windows Phone、Android和iOS操作系统的智能设备。2012年,他协助组织并出席了法国波尔多大学的复杂数据挖掘国际论坛——EGC 2012。他还是《RavenDB 2.x Beginner's Guide》一书的作者。

ଏହି ଇବୁକ୍‍କୁ ମୂଲ୍ୟାଙ୍କନ କରନ୍ତୁ

ଆପଣ କଣ ଭାବୁଛନ୍ତି ତାହା ଆମକୁ ଜଣାନ୍ତୁ।

ପଢ଼ିବା ପାଇଁ ତଥ୍ୟ

ସ୍ମାର୍ଟଫୋନ ଓ ଟାବଲେଟ
Google Play Books ଆପ୍କୁ, AndroidiPad/iPhone ପାଇଁ ଇନଷ୍ଟଲ୍ କରନ୍ତୁ। ଏହା ସ୍ଵଚାଳିତ ଭାବେ ଆପଣଙ୍କ ଆକାଉଣ୍ଟରେ ସିଙ୍କ ହୋ‍ଇଯିବ ଏବଂ ଆପଣ ଯେଉଁଠି ଥାଆନ୍ତୁ ନା କାହିଁକି ଆନଲାଇନ୍ କିମ୍ବା ଅଫଲାଇନ୍‍ରେ ପଢ଼ିବା ପାଇଁ ଅନୁମତି ଦେବ।
ଲାପଟପ ଓ କମ୍ପ୍ୟୁଟର
ନିଜର କମ୍ପ୍ୟୁଟର୍‍ରେ ଥିବା ୱେବ୍ ବ୍ରାଉଜର୍‍କୁ ବ୍ୟବହାର କରି Google Playରୁ କିଣିଥିବା ଅଡିଓବୁକ୍‍କୁ ଆପଣ ଶୁଣିପାରିବେ।
ଇ-ରିଡର୍ ଓ ଅନ୍ୟ ଡିଭାଇସ୍‍ଗୁଡ଼ିକ
Kobo eReaders ପରି e-ink ଡିଭାଇସଗୁଡ଼ିକରେ ପଢ଼ିବା ପାଇଁ, ଆପଣଙ୍କୁ ଏକ ଫାଇଲ ଡାଉନଲୋଡ କରି ଏହାକୁ ଆପଣଙ୍କ ଡିଭାଇସକୁ ଟ୍ରାନ୍ସଫର କରିବାକୁ ହେବ। ସମର୍ଥିତ eReadersକୁ ଫାଇଲଗୁଡ଼ିକ ଟ୍ରାନ୍ସଫର କରିବା ପାଇଁ ସହାୟତା କେନ୍ଦ୍ରରେ ଥିବା ସବିଶେଷ ନିର୍ଦ୍ଦେଶାବଳୀକୁ ଅନୁସରଣ କରନ୍ତୁ।